SILBERMAN, Judge.

Joseph R. Ganey, Jr., pro se, appeals the denial of his motion for postconviction relief filed pursuant to Florida Rule of Criminal Procedure 3.850. Ganey argues that his no contest plea was not knowingly and voluntarily entered because it was based on incorrect information as to his sentencing guidelines range. We agree and reverse.
